The award seeks to recognise exceptional shopping centre design together with its economic success within the South African property industry, embodying the following attributes: Excellent design resolution; Achieving a clear overall development goal; Responding positively to its market and its surroundings; Adopting innovative design and construction solutions and embracing sustainable design and business techniques.
Matlosana Mall, which opened in October 2014, is a 65000sqm development on the N12 highway on the eastern side of Klerksdorp, owned and developed by JSE-listed SA REIT, Redefine Properties, and designed by architect Stauch Vorster International.

The mall has a centrally focused entertainment area consisting of a six auditorium cinema complex and restaurants clustered around a piazza with indoor and outdoor dining facilities. The predominant access is to the Piazza further emphasized by an iconic feature described as the "basket" which acts as a focal land mark for the centre. There is a strong emphasis on natural day lighting design allowing natural light to permeate the centre.
